Crunchyroll will begin streaming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ba Infinity Castle I (Part 1) on July 28–29, 2026, in Japanese with an English dub option, following a near-record theatrical run that earned $793.5 million worldwide and a 2026 Anime Awards Film of the Year win.
After nearly a year of waiting, the streaming release date for the biggest anime box-office hit of 2025 has finally emerged. Here is everything confirmed so far.

— report that Demon Slayer: Infinity Castle (Part 1, "Akaza Returns") will begin streaming on Crunchyroll in late July 2026. The exact dates vary slightly by source:
An earlier April 2026 date from a single less-authoritative source appears to have been erroneous; the July date is now widely corroborated .
The streaming release will mirror the theatrical presentation: original Japanese audio and an English dub version will both be available . Additional dubbing and subtitle languages were also mentioned by Crunchyroll, though the full list has not yet been published.
Crunchyroll's global rollout is expected to follow its standard wide international availability. The film's theatrical release was distributed by Crunchyroll through Sony Pictures Releasing across most territories, including the U.S., Canada, the UK, and select Asian countries . The streaming release is anticipated in the same broad regions, though Crunchyroll had not, as of the most recent reports, published a formal list of every territory.

The streaming date was first revealed via a leaked Amazon Prime Video Canada listing and later confirmed by multiple outlets including Forbes and Polygon.
The film is the first part of a planned trilogy; no release dates have been announced for Part 2 or Part 3.
